以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  为什么删除行变成删除表?  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=146492)

--  作者:采菊东篱下
--  发布时间:2020/2/25 10:12:00
--  为什么删除行变成删除表?
    删除订单表中的行会变成删除表,这种情况试过多次,现在我在表属性中设置了不允许删除行,我希望用程序设置不允许删除表,如在订单没被引用下允许修改、删除行的。
 下载信息  [文件大小:   下载次数: ]
图片点击可在新窗口打开查看点击浏览该文件:在编写代码.rar

密码:111111
[此贴子已经被作者于2020/2/25 10:12:14编辑过]

--  作者:有点蓝
--  发布时间:2020/2/25 10:40:00
--  
不要在PrepareEdit事件设置AutoSizeRow,这个事件执行很频繁,会导致项目卡。

至于删除订单表中的行会变成删除表,是怎么操作的?哪个窗口?

--  作者:采菊东篱下
--  发布时间:2020/2/25 11:11:00
--  
在订单表删除行,就变成了把表删除了,我昨天很清楚选定了两行,结果把订单表删除了,幸好之前把项目上传到论坛,我上论坛重新下载才要回项目。
--  作者:有点蓝
--  发布时间:2020/2/25 11:30:00
--  
在订单数量表选定了两行?使用右键菜单的删除行?还是点击上面主菜单的删除按钮?还是自己写代码删除的?
--  作者:采菊东篱下
--  发布时间:2020/2/25 11:45:00
--  
点击上面主菜单的删除按钮
--  作者:有点蓝
--  发布时间:2020/2/25 11:49:00
--  
我测试了很多次都没有问题,您肯定是点击错按钮,点了删除表按钮了。

何况这个表设置了不能删除行,菜单是删除不了行的。

--  作者:采菊东篱下
--  发布时间:2020/2/25 11:55:00
--  
表设置了不能删除行是我今天早上刚设置的,这表一直有问题,我跟同事交待过不允许删除行,否则表没了,这不是一时一事!
--  作者:采菊东篱下
--  发布时间:2020/2/25 11:57:00
--  
 没设置不允许删除表时,可以选定单元格点delete,但不要删除行,一删除出问题了。
--  作者:有点蓝
--  发布时间:2020/2/25 12:06:00
--  
不可能有这种问题的。肯定是手误。是不是选中了2列,而不是2行啊。选中列就相当于选中所有行了
--  作者:采菊东篱下
--  发布时间:2020/2/25 14:04:00
--  
    我刚升级了最新版,之前的版本删除行或表没弹窗提示是否删除行或表吧,我记得昨天点导行栏上的删除行没任何提示,计划表直接没了,这应不是操作错操,删除表在数据表选项卡,删除行在日常工作选项卡,我记得我点的是删除行,这问题以前不止一次出现过,以前遇过删除关联表上的某些行,会把这个产品名称的所有计划单据在计划表中删除,造成订单缺失错误,所以我没设关联、查询,小心操作。
[此贴子已经被作者于2020/2/25 14:35:40编辑过]